Causes of Open Circuit in Current Transformers:
Overload: When the rated current on the secondary side of the current transformer exceeds its capacity, the internal windings will overheat and burn out, causing the transformer to malfunction.
Short Circuit: A short circuit on the secondary side of the current transformer can cause excessive current, burning out the internal windings and resulting in an open circuit.
Loose Connections: Loose internal connections can prevent current flow, leading to an open circuit.
Aging: The materials and electrical properties of the current transformer windings deteriorate over time, potentially causing open circuits or other faults.
Solutions:
Regular Inspection and Maintenance: Current transformers require regular inspection and maintenance. Check for loose connections or poor contact in the windings. Also, check the electrical performance of the windings.
Replace the Core: If the magnetic performance of the current transformer core deteriorates, replace it promptly to ensure normal operation.
Adjust the current transformer connection: If the current transformer connection is incorrect, it should be adjusted to avoid open circuit faults.
Replace the current transformer: If the current transformer is aged or cannot be repaired for other reasons, a new current transformer needs to be replaced to ensure the normal operation of the system.
